Antony hopes fair solution to pay panel anomalies
New Delhi, Apr 28 (UNI) Defence Minister A K Antony today expressed hope that a fair solution to various anomalies relating to the armed forces in the Sixth Pay Commission would be achieved soon.
Addressing the Army Commanders' Conference here, Mr Antony said the three services had pointed out various anomalies in the Sixth Pay Commission report and these were being taken up at the appropriate level.
''I hope a fair solution will be arrived at the earliest.
Our Government is keen to improve other service conditions such as married accommodation project and enhancing opportunities for providing the best education for children of the armed forces personnel,'' he added.
